Alaska Statutes Sec. 04.16.052 - Furnishing of Alcoholic Beverages to Persons Under the Age of 21 by Licensees

A licensee or an agent or employee of the licensee may not with criminal negligence

(1) allow another person to sell, barter, or give an alcoholic beverage to a person under the age of 21 years within licensed premises;

(2) allow a person under the age of 21 years to enter and remain within licensed premises except as provided in AS 04.16.049 ;

(3) allow a person under the age of 21 years to consume an alcoholic beverage within licensed premises;

(4) allow a person under the age of 21 years to sell or serve alcoholic beverages;

(5) while working on licensed premises, furnish or deliver alcoholic beverages to a person under the age of 21 years.
